Syngonium White Butterfly care requirements
These care conditions are most relevant to slow growth in Syngonium White Butterfly. Check each one as a potential cause.
light_mode
Light
Bright, indirect light; tolerates low light but variegation fades without sufficient brightness
science
Fertiliser
Monthly diluted balanced liquid fertilizer during growing season (spring-summer)
thermometer
Temperature
65–75°F (18–24°C); avoid cold drafts below 60°F

Symptoms to look for in Syngonium White Butterfly
- fiber_manual_recordLittle to no new growth
- fiber_manual_recordStagnant development
help
Common causes in Syngonium White Butterfly
- fiber_manual_recordLow light
- fiber_manual_recordPoor nutrition
- fiber_manual_recordRoot-bound
- fiber_manual_recordWrong season
- fiber_manual_recordOverwatering
troubleshoot
How to diagnose slow growth in Syngonium White Butterfly
Assess light levels, feeding schedule, and pot size.
healing
How to treat slow growth in Syngonium White Butterfly
Move to brighter spot. Feed regularly during growing season. Repot if root-bound.
shield
Preventing slow growth in Syngonium White Butterfly
Regular feeding. Adequate light. Annual pot size check.
